Json
in package
implements
SerializerInterface
Table of Contents
Interfaces
Constants
- JSON_DECODE_ERROR_MESSAGE = 'Decoding payload to json failed: "%s".'
- JSON_ENCODE_ERROR_MESSAGE = 'Encoding payload to json failed: "%s".'
Methods
- serialize() : string|bool
- Serialize data into string.
- unserialize() : string|int|float|bool|array<string|int, mixed>|null
- Unserialize the given string.
Constants
JSON_DECODE_ERROR_MESSAGE
private
mixed
JSON_DECODE_ERROR_MESSAGE
= 'Decoding payload to json failed: "%s".'
JSON_ENCODE_ERROR_MESSAGE
private
mixed
JSON_ENCODE_ERROR_MESSAGE
= 'Encoding payload to json failed: "%s".'
Methods
serialize()
Serialize data into string.
public
serialize(mixed $data) : string|bool
Parameters
- $data : mixed
Return values
string|boolunserialize()
Unserialize the given string.
public
unserialize(string $string) : string|int|float|bool|array<string|int, mixed>|null
Parameters
- $string : string